The given maps compare the layout of a school in 1985 with its current state, emphasising improvements in infrastructure and facilities over time. Overall, the school has modernized and expanded its facilities to support the growing student population and improve educational resources.
The school had 1,500 students enrolled in 1985. At that time, the structure of the school was simple with a parking lot located at the top center, a two-story classroom block on the right, and a library and classrooms on the left at that time. There were playing fields occupying a large area in the bottom half of the school grounds, allowing for outdoor activities.
By contrast, the school has recently undergone major construction to handle an increased student enrollment of 2,300. The large parking area has been remodelled into a circular form but the small car park and the connected road have disappeared. Moreover, the school building has been transformed to three stories, with more classrooms added. The office area remains unchanged in location, situated in the top-left corner. However, new amenities, such as a learning resource centre and a computer room, have been added near the office, replacing the library, which was located adjacent to the office in 1985. In addition, trees have also been planted, which improves the school’s overall appearance.
